RUTH NAOMI ELVEY's Obituary
Ruth N. Elvey, age 87 of Dagsboro, DE, formerly of Enola, PA went home to be with the Lord on Saturday, June 18, 2016.
She worked as an accountant for various companies for many years before working for the Delaware State Parks and Recreations at the time of her passing. Ruth was very independent, loved going to church, drinking her black coffee, working and spending time with her family. She will be greatly missed by all who knew her.
Ruth was preceded in death by her husband Donald Elvey, her special friend Julian Woods "Woody" , and a son John Hoffman.
She is survived by her daughter, JoMarie McClintock and her husband Donald of PA, her son, Bradley Hall and his wife Kim of Dagsboro, DE; five grandchildren, Shelly Darhower and her husband Michael of PA, Dawn Louise Kell of PA, David Hall and his wife Amy of Dagsboro, DE; Chelsey Hall of Dagsboro, DE, Leah Hudson and her fiancé Andy Bradford of Millsboro, DE; eight great grandchildren, Emmanuel Darhower , Tyson Darhower, Brianna, David Jr. and Nathan Hall, Ryan, Kayley and Avery Bradford and one great great grandson Lane Darhower.
Services and interment will be private. In lieu of flowers the family suggests contributions in Ruth's memory to Blackwater Fellowship Church, P.O. Box 549, Frankford, DE 19945.
